THIS METHOD OF UPLOADING PHOTOS IS NO LONGER SUPPORTED!

At the top of the forum, to the right you will see a new button linking to the Gallery. We can add all our favourite photographs directly into the forum now. Over the next few weeks, I will integrating the gallery into the forum more, so that the pictures show up a lot easier in posts and on the site generally.

Each user has their own personal gallery and you can have albums in your own gallery. In my case, I have an album for Rupert and Watson. I also have a mixed bag album. You need to create an album in order to upload photo's to the forum.

Adding photographs to your album
  • Navigate to the gallery using the link at the top of the page.
  • At the top of the page you will see a row of tabs and a row of links. In the row of links, you will find a link called 'Upload Photo' link. Image Click on it.
  • You will presented with an 'UPLOAD PHOTOS' page. Follow the instructions on the page and upload your photo's. Remember to select which album you want them to go into.
  • Once the upload process is complete, the status bar will disappear and you will be taken to the next page where you can add a title, description and optional key words to the photo. Please be patient whilst uploading. It may look like the bar is stuck, but it is just processing.
  • Once you have finished adding a title, description and optional keywords, click on the Apply Changes' button and your information will be saved.
  • Once completed, you can navigate back to the galleries using the links at the top of the page or one of the tabs.
Adding your photograph into your post on the forum
Above any of the white message boxes on the Forum, you will see a row of buttons. These include URL, Quote, etc. I have added a new one called GALLERY. (Please note that you will only see it if you have uploaded photo's to the Schnauzer Gallery). If you click on the 'GALLERY' button, you will see all your photographs from your personal gallery in a box below your message. It's between the message box and the DRAFT PREVIEW SUBMIT buttons. When you are at the point where you want to insert the photo, simply click on the thumbnail and the correct code will be inserted. The box closed automatically when you click on a picture. If you want it include another picture, simply click on the 'Gallery' button again and repeat the process.

Alternatively, from the gallery itself:
  • Find the photo you want to link to or use in your post.
  • Click on it and you will be taken to a larger thumbnail with the smaller thumbnails in a film strip to the right.
  • Below the photo, you will see a box containing the all the Photo Information.
  • The last entry is entitled 'BBCode (fullsize)@. Copy the text from the white box and you can paste it anywhere in your message. There is no need to alter the code or do anything else.
  • If you wish to link to the photo, use the 'URL' code, which is just above Favourites.
And we are done. Hope you have fun using it. We all love photo's and it is going to be nice seeing them all together in the Gallery.

In the "Board Index" click on the section you want to post in. You will see a list of topics that have already been posted. Just to the top left of the list there is a box that says "New Topic". Click on this box and in the "Subject" line enter what your topic is about, then just write and submit your post as normal.
